Storage services vary depending on the company. ![]() This way, you don’t have to unload everything into a storage unit as part of your move!īecause of this, moving containers are sometimes used as residential storage containers, as some companies allow you to rent your containers indefinitely for onsite storage. Some of these companies also offer short and long-term storage options, such as climate-controlled storage facilities where you can keep your container until you’re ready to move into your new place. Once you’ve packed your containers, the company will pick them up and transport them to your destination. The company will drop off the containers at home, after which you’ll generally have a set number of business days to load everything up. You order the number of containers you need for your move. Regardless of the company you use, most follow a similar business model. Dozens of these companies have popped up since portable storage containers became a thing in the late ‘90s.
